Calvin Claude Woodard

Mr. Calvin Claude Woodard, 94, passed away, Sunday, February 11, 2018 at his home surrounded by loved ones.

Mr. Woodard was born December 9, 1923 in Northampton County.  

The funeral service will be conducted at Askew Funeral in Jackson, NC, officiated by the Reverend Ricky Barnes. Interment will follow at the Woodard Family Cemetery.

Mr. Woodard, a native of Northampton County, lived most of his life in the Margarettsville community.  

He was a member of the Margarettsville Baptist Church where he served as a Deacon.

He was a veteran of the U S Navy where he excelled and enjoyed participating in boxing.

He was an avid farmer for over 70 years and owner of Woodard Peanut Buying Station for many years.  

He was a hard-working man, who loved his hobbies of restoring old cars, taking nature walks looking for turkeys and deer, and riding the countryside watching the crops being planted, grow, and harvested.  

He especially loved and treasured his children, grandchildren, and great grandchildren.
